The Play 60 program was in full swing Saturday afternoon in Lehigh County.
Kids and coaches gathered at Camp Olympic in Emmaus to play in a flag football tournament.
Around 150 kids signed up for the NFL-licensed event that was launched in 2007 to encourage kids to go outside and play at least 60 minutes a day.
"A lot of kids these days are spending their time in front of screens. This gets them out..gets kids who may never play an organized sport like football, gives them a chance to be apart of a team. Everybody plays every position, so there is nobody left out. No favorites, no favoritism. It gets them out and having a good time," said coach Brooke Moyer.
The NFL has dedicated more than $200 million to help fight child obesity.
